The A14 IDT is made up of three civil engineering companies and two design consultancies, working on behalf of Highways England to improve the A14 road between Cambridge and Huntingdon.

Types of apprenticeships:
Construction, civil engineering and plant maintenance.

In over 100 countries, AstraZeneca is a global biopharmaceutical focusing on the discovery, development and manufacture of some of the world’s most cutting edge medicines, with 64,600 employees worldwide, 6,400 in the UK. We are one of a handful of companies to span the entire life-cycle of medicines from research and development, manufacturing and supply and global commercialisation, partnering with academia, governments, industry/scientific organisations globally to access the best science accelerating the delivery of new medicines to unmet medical need.

Bouygues UK is one of the country’s leading construction companies. The company focuses on sectors where it is particularly well positioned to add value through its technical expertise, skills and experience, drawing on the talents of the wider global Bouygues Group.

Types of apprenticeships:
Civil engineering and Business Administration.

Cambridge University Press is part of the University of Cambridge. It furthers the University’s mission by disseminating knowledge in the pursuit of education, learning and research at the highest international levels of excellence.

Types of apprenticeships:
Publishing and Business Administration.

Marshall Aerospace and Defence Group is one of the largest privately owned and independent aerospace and defence companies that delivers innovation and excellence in engineering and support solutions in the air, on land and at sea.

Types of apprenticeships:
Aerospace engineering, manufacturing and business administration.

Marshall is proud to be a private, family owned group, fully committed to maintaining our values and our relationships with our employees, customers, suppliers, shareholders and local communities. We develop and deliver world leading applied engineering services and technology. The innovative Hercules Integrated Operational Support (HIOS) programme, which is a joint partnership between the UK Ministry of Defence, Marshall Aerospace and Defence Group, Rolls-Royce and Lockheed Martin, provides long-term support for the Royal Air Force C-130 fleet. On land we have a proven pedigree of delivery – we support the UK Armed Forces and other organisations around the globe with innovative maintenance and logistics programmes for complex redeployable infrastructure and logistic vehicles.

Types of apprenticeships:
Engineering Technician Standard; Engineering Fitter Standard.

With over 8,200 talented people in the UK and 48,000 globally, we engineer projects that will help societies grow for lifetimes to come. Our projects include the re-development of London Bridge Station, One Blackfriars, and the Shard. WSP is one of the world’s leading engineering professional services consulting firms. We are technical experts and strategic advisors including engineers, technicians, scientists, architects, planners, surveyors and environmental specialists, as well as other design and construction management professionals. We design lasting solutions in the Property & Buildings, Transportation & Infrastructure, Environment, Industry, Resources, Power & Energy sectors, project delivery and strategic consulting services.

Types of apprenticeships:
Civil Engineer.
